From: RNA virus interference via CRISPR/Cas13a system in plants

Fig. 2

The pCas13a–crRNA complex interferes with TuMV-GFP in planta. a pCas13a mediates interference with the GFP-expressing TuMV virus in plants. N. benthamiana plants expressing pCas13a were infiltrated with TRV expressing crRNAs and TuMV-GFP. At 7 dpi, plants were imaged under UV light for GFP. The GFP signal of the plants having target crRNAs were compared to plants having no crRNA or a ns-crRNA. b GFP protein detection was used to validate the TuMV-GFP interference. Protein blots from (a) were developed with anti-GFP antibody. The arrow indicates the size of the GFP band. c Northern blot confirms that Hc-crRNA and GFP2-crRNA give better interference with TuMV. RNA blots from (a) were probed with a DIG-labeled TuMV complementary (250-nt) RNA fragment and detected with anti-DIG antibody. The arrow indicates the accumulation of the TuMV RNA genome. In (b) and (c) the lower panels were used as loading controls
